GUITAR RIG 5 PRO is the ultimate software solution for perfect custom tone with more amps, more effects and more creative potential than ever before, all in a powerful and intuitive virtual effects rack. The latest version includes two essential new high-gain amps, six powerful new effects, and 19 new cabinets — exquisitely modeled in stunning sonic detail. And for complete custom control and a new level of realism, GUITAR RIG 5 PRO gives you the all-new Control Room Pro. Premium sound quality, maximum flexibility and total control for guitar, bass and more.

The Ultimate Guide to PSU Requirements: Powering Your PC in 2026
: Modern high-end cards like the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3080 have a maximum power draw of 320 W and require a minimum 750 W PSU . Emerging cards like the AMD Radeon RX 9070 XT are expected to recommend a 750 W unit, while some overclocked variants like the PowerColor Red Devil may demand as much as 900 W .

Choosing a Power Supply Unit (PSU) is often the most overlooked part of building a PC, yet it is arguably the most critical. A PSU doesn't just provide "juice"; it regulates the lifeblood of your expensive components. If you under-power your system, you risk crashes, data loss, or even permanent hardware failure.
